## ----eval=F, echo=T-----------------------------------------------------------
#  
#  install.packages("BiocManager")
#  BiocManager::install("uncoverappLib")
#  library(uncoverappLib)

## ----eval=F, echo=T-----------------------------------------------------------
#  
#  library(devtools)
#  install_github("Manuelaio/uncoverappLib")
#  library(uncoverappLib)
#

## ----eval=TRUE, echo=TRUE-----------------------------------------------------
library(dplyr)

gene.list<- system.file("extdata", "mygene.txt", package = "uncoverappLib")

bam_example <- system.file("extdata", "example_POLG.bam", package = "uncoverappLib")
cat(bam_example, file = "bam.list", sep = "\n")
temp_dir=tempdir()
buildInput(geneList= gene.list, genome= "hg19", type_bam= "chr", 
           bamList= "bam.list", outDir= temp_dir)
